What is WorkWell?

WorkWell is a new service designed to support people with health conditions or disabilities who are:

  • Looking to start a new job
  • Needing support to stay in their current role
  • Planning to return to work after an absence

Why choose WorkWell?

  • Personalised support: One-on-one sessions with a dedicated Work and Health Coach
  • Tailored services: Access to physiotherapy, counselling, and other specialist services
  • Workplace solutions: Advice on reasonable adjustments to enhance job performance
  • Completely voluntary: Participation on individual terms, regardless of benefit status
  • Local focus: Designed specifically for residents in Barnet, Camden, Enfield, Haringey, and Islington
  • Integrated care: Collaboration with healthcare providers to ensure comprehensive support

Who Can Participate?

WorkWell is open to anyone in Barnet, Camden, Enfield, Haringey, and Islington with a health condition or disability who wants to improve their work situation.

Further details and additional health and work support

WorkWell is part of a national pilot scheme. It is a partnership between the North Central London Integrated Care Board, local authorities, intermediaries, and voluntary sector organisations across Barnet, Camden, Enfield, Haringey and Islington. It is jointly sponsored by the Department for Work and Pensions and the Department of Health and Social Care.

For some residents in Barnet, their postcode may be on the geographical border of the service, making them not eligible within the North Central London programme. If so, they can express an interest in the WorkWell in North West London.

In addition to the WorkWell programme, residents in Barnet, Enfield, Haringey can access Thrive into Work, an Individual Placement and Support programme for people who have been unable to work for a significant period of time.
